Transaction 91ca80a8e98f51c573f2576194353477889209ab22231a689f5f76dde35a9190

1 Input
2 Outputs
  • 91ca80a8e98f51c573f2576194353477889209ab22231a689f5f76dde35a9190:0
  • value  13430000
    address  18QKbpfq13vv5ToA4B4E9zgZhq5UzvH16e
  • 91ca80a8e98f51c573f2576194353477889209ab22231a689f5f76dde35a9190:1
  • value  478637
    address  1MtqmZZFXjjRGZzamhHbSJsMW35oHk82Le